The Houston Christian Mustangs will play host again on Tuesday to welcome the Bay Area Christian Broncos, where first pitch is scheduled at 5:00 p.m. Houston Christian is strutting in with some hitting muscle, as they've averaged 7.3 runs per game this season.
On Monday, Houston Christian got themselves on the board against Legacy School of Sport Sciences, but Legacy School of Sport Sciences never followed suit. They blew past the Titans 10-0.
Millie Metz made a splash no matter where she played. She didn't allow a single earned run and only two hits while striking out six over five innings pitched. Metz was also solid in the batter's box, scoring two runs and stealing two bases.
In other batting news, Maddie Pickett and MC Been did most of the damage at the plate: Pickett scored a run and stole a base while getting on base in all three of her plate appearances, while Been scored a run and stole a base while going 2-for-3.
Meanwhile, Bay Area Christian was not able to break out of their rough patch two weeks ago as the team picked up their sixth straight defeat. They wound up on the wrong side of a rough 11-3 walloping at the hands of Concordia Lutheran.
Houston Christian's win bumped their record up to 9-6. As for Bay Area Christian, their loss dropped their record down to 0-2.
